## Data Stores — Zero-Downtime Migrations

Plugin authors: schema changes in the Tallowkeep core go through expand-contract. Additive columns first, dual-write window of one release, then contract. Never ship a plugin migration that drops or renames columns directly; file it through the Tallowkeep migration queue instead. Backfills run in 10k-row batches with a 200ms pause. Test every migration against the shared staging database before submitting. Reach staging with the connection string that follows.

primary connection of tawif-yajeg = postgresql://rusiel_svc:G879q9cx6GsSvj@db-dd9f.norvagrid.internal:5432/casath

The Orvik query planner in release 4.8 regressed on correlated subqueries, choosing nested-loop joins where hash joins previously applied. Plugin authors whose extensions issue such queries may see latency increases up to 10x. A hotfix flag, planner.legacy_join_costing, restores 4.7 behavior and is safe for production. To verify whether your plugin is affected, run the diagnostics suite against the Orvik staging endpoint, which reports plan diffs per query. Diagnostics requests authenticate via the internal service key shown below.

gateway credential: kto23_LX9A4ys6i4nzHtpOLNLodKK

Ceremony step 12 — Barcode scanner keys. Heads up, future maintainers: the Scanport integration signs every scan payload before handing it to the Ledgerbin inventory service, and those signing keys get rotated at this ceremony. Double-check the handheld firmware is at least 3.4 or the new keys won't load (we learned that the hard way). Once both custodians confirm rotation, archive the old keypair to the offline drawer. To reopen that archive later, you'll need the recovery passphrase that appears just below.

unlock words, yagep-fahof: belix-rusvan-casdor-gorox-aldath-norael-istix-quenael-fraeth-silael